Smith and Bybee Lakes are one of the best kept secrets in Portland and a fantastic place to kayak. This 2,000-acre nature reserve is home to a multitude of wildlife - ospreys, bald eagles and beavers, to name a few - and is the largest protected urban wetland in the nation. 100+ species of birds have been observed in the wetlands and Smith and Bybee hosts the largest population of the threatened Western Painted Turtle west of the Cascade Mountains.
To make sure everyone has a great time, we'll start with a lesson from Next Adventure's kayak instructors. We'll paddle super-stable recreational kayaks through a series of inter-connected sloughs, waterways and lakes. The higher water of the spring will allow us to wind our way into secluded areas and sneak up on some beaver lodges. This all-day paddling adventure will include a fantastic lunch halfway through the trip on one of the islands where we've spotted black-tailed deer and muskrats. Sea Kayak Adventure: Ridgefield National Wildlife Refuge

Known for its expansive grassland and wetland habitat of 5,218 acres, the Ridgefield National Wildlife Refuge is home to huge concentrations of both migratory waterfowl and resident birdlife. Ridgefield is home to dozens of bird species and seasonal migration patterns swell wildlife numbers into the thousands. Over 200 different species have been spotted in this wildlife refuge. Kayaks are in an incredible vehicle for exploring the waterways and sloughs intertwined around Bachelor Island.

Our Sea Kayak Rescues & Recoveries class teaches beginner and experienced sea kayakers the answer to the always-asked "What happens if I flip over?" the fundamentals of self-rescue. Covering essential techniques like the wet exit, the t-rescue and the paddle float rescue, this class will make each student a safer paddler. We'll prepare each student for a capsize and give them tools for success and confidence, all while smiling.
